Timberwolves' Naz Reid: Leads team to upset win
Reid racked up a game-high 27 points (11-18 FG, 3-9 3Pt, 2-2 FT), 14 rebounds, seven assists and one block over 38 minutes during Thursday's 116-101 victory over the Thunder.
With Rudy Gobert (back) and Julius Randle (groin) both unavailable, Reid stepped up and led all scorers on the night while setting new season highs in boards and assists. The 25-year-old big has started eight straight games in place of Randle, and over the last seven, he's averaged 21.3 points, 9.6 rebounds, 4.0 assists, 3.0 threes and 1.4 blocks.

Timberwolves' Naz Reid: Posts double-double
Reid closed Wednesday's 103-101 loss to the Bucks with 22 points (7-17 FG, 1-7 3Pt, 7-7 FT), 13 rebounds, two assists and one block in 33 minutes.
The Timberwolves had to settle for a two-point loss in this tight contest, but Reid still managed to deliver an impressive stat line as he continues to fill a starting role due to the absence of Julius Randle (thigh). Reid has three double-doubles over his last five appearances and is averaging 18.6 points, 8.0 rebounds and 3.0 assists per game since being promoted to a starting nod.

Timberwolves' Naz Reid: Leaves early with sprained finger
Reid has been ruled out for the rest of Saturday's game against the Wizards due to a right finger sprain. He finished with eight points (3-10 FG, 2-6 3Pt) and three rebounds over 20 minutes.
Making his first start of the season in place of the injured Julius Randle (groin), Reid was forced out of the contest early in the third quarter after injuring a finger while setting a screen for Mike Conley. Further testing following the game will determine the severity of the injury, but for now, Reid looks to be day-to-day heading into Monday's contest against the Kings. With Randle facing an uncertain return timeline, Reid should be in store for major minutes Monday if his sprained finger doesn't keep him from playing.

Timberwolves' Naz Reid: Starting Saturday vs. Washington
Reid will be in the Timberwolves' starting lineup against the Wizards on Saturday, Jon Krawczynski of The Athletic reports.
Head coach Chris Finch told reporters Saturday that he expects the Timberwolves to be without Julius Randle "for the near future" due to a right groin strain that he suffered in Thursday's 138-113 win over the Jazz. Reid will make his first start of the 2024-25 regular season Saturday and will likely remain in the Timberwolves' starting five for as long as Randle is sidelined. Reid averaged 16.1 points on 54.4 percent shooting (including 57.5 percent from three on 5.3 3PA/G), 5.3 rebounds, 2.1 assists and 0.9 steals over 26.9 minutes per game in January.

Timberwolves' Naz Reid: Posts double-double
Reid notched 13 points (6-16 FG, 1-5 3Pt, 0-1 FT), 12 rebounds, one assist and one block across 23 minutes during Tuesday's 104-97 win over the Pelicans.
Reid had a strong showing and recorded his first double-double since Oct. 24. His overall numbers have slightly decreased compared to the 2023-24 season, and while he remains a reliable option in fantasy due to his heavy workload and usage rate off the bench, his upside is currently capped. Last season, Reid shot a career-high 41.4 percent from deep which led to 2.1 made three-pointers per game. This season, Reid is shooting 35 percent from deep and making only 1.7 threes a night.
